In his role as COO at Gray Solutions, Drew Goodall oversees and supports all aspects of our technical delivery teams and drives strategic initiatives to ensure the company's growth and success.

Throughout his career, Drew worked to build exceptional leadership skills and a deep understanding of system integration. His expertise lies in optimizing operational efficiency, fostering innovation, and implementing effective business strategies to achieve organizational objectives. The combination of a strong analytical mindset with technical knowledge helps him make data-driven decisions that lead to tangible results.

Drew has a degree in Biosystems Engineering from the University of Kentucky and has completed several professional development programs to stay at the forefront of tech advancements in our industry, which he believes is essential to remaining competitive. Equally important in this rapidly evolving industry is embracing emerging technologies alongside proven results, and he continuously seeks out opportunities for our team to do so to enhance our service offerings and provide customers with cutting-edge outcomes. 

On a personal level, Drew pursues ongoing learning and professional growth out of a commitment to excellence and continuous improvement. He’s dedicated to driving our company's vision forward, building a culture of innovation.

Drew values wisdom and humility, and ensures that our company operates with integrity, compassion, and a genuine devotion to the success of both our customers and team members. 

When he’s not working, Drew enjoys spending time with family, traveling, hiking, trail running, and snowboarding.
